This new edition of Ann Bowling's well-known and highly respected text has been thoroughly revised and updated to reflect key methodological developments in health research. It is a comprehensive, easy to read, guide to the range of methods used to study and evaluate health and health services. It describes the concepts and methods used by the main disciplines involved in health research, including: demography, epidemiology, health economics, psychology and sociology.
The research methods described cover the assessment of health needs, morbidity and mortality trends and rates, costing health services, sampling for survey research, cross-sectional and longitudinal survey design, experimental methods and techniques of group assignment, questionnaire design, interviewing techniques, coding and analysis of quantitative data, methods and analysis of qualitative observational studies, and types of unstructured interviewing.
With new material on topics such as cluster randomization, utility analyses, patients' preferences, and perception of risk, the text is aimed at students and researchers of health and health services. It has also been designed for health professionals and policy makers who have responsibility for applying research findings in practice, and who need to know how to judge the value of that research.

Ann Bowling is a social scientist and is currently Professor of Health Services Research in the Department of Primary Care and Population Sciences at University College London. She directs an active research programme and has both PhD and master's programmes, including the MRes in health services research and policy at UCL. She is also author of Measuring Health, A Review of Quality of Life Measurement Scales and Measuring Disease, A Review of Disease-Specific Quality of Life Measurement Scales, both published by the Open University Press.
Ian Rees Jones is Professor of Sociology of Health and Illness, St George's Hospital Medical School, London. He is also a social scientist with an extensive research background, and teaches on both undergraduate and post-graduate courses.
